The Tottori Sand Dunes
- 鳥取砂丘
- Tottori
This is one of the largest sand dunes in Japan, which extends 2.4 km from north to south and 16 km from east to west. You can enjoy paragliding, sand boarding, camel back riding, sightseeing horse carriages, or visiting the many tourist attractions. It's covered with snow in the winter, as shown in the picture.

Point
Shortly after the dawn is the most ideal moment to take a picture or to enjoy a quiet scenery. Take extra precautions to prevent heat-related illnesses during the summer.
-
Nearest Station/IC Access
Take the local bus to "Tottori Sakyu (sand dunes)" from "JR Tottori station" and get off at "Tottori Sakyu" stop. (Kirin Jishi Loop Bus to the sand dunes operates on weekends and national holidays. )
About 20 minutes drive from the Sayo JCT on the Chugoku Expressway to the Tottori IC on the Tottori Expressway. About 80 minutes drive from Sayo.
